This study will investigate the impact of dimenydrinate (H1-receptor antagonist) versus ondansetron (HT3-receptor antagonist) in postoperative nausea and vomiting, in surgery-related preoperative stress and in the incidence of postoperative complications that could lengthen the LOS in PACU and/or the overall LOS.
Dimenydrinate has been extensively used for motion sickness. However, as far as postoperative nausea and vomiting is concerned the results are still conflicting.
